BIGGLES IN AFRICA

by W.E. Johns

Illustrated by Howard Leigh; Alfred Sindall

Published by Oxford University Press; Humphrey Milford. 1936

Slightly better than good condition. Pyramid edition. Blue cloth, black titles and sketch of plane gliding over pyramids & palm trees. Colour frontis and 7 b/w illustrations. 256 pages.

Spine and corners bumped and worn. 3" split in cloth at rear of spine. Corners browned. Covers marked and grubby. Name in pencil and part of an address in ink to front endpaper plus a few small scratch marks and dents. Rear joint cracked just before last chapter. A few hinges also cracked. Foxing throughout.

Contents

  • Biggles and Co are employed by a rich father to track down his missing son who disappeared whilst attempting the flight record from England to South Africa.
  • Tthe team fly to Africa looking for the missing aviator. They battle against all manner of problems; wild animals as well as natives in the pay of hashish smugglers.
